Delta Air Lines pilots agreed to a new contract on Wednesday, giving pilots a hefty 34% pay increase over three years. Roughly 78% of Delta’s 15,000 pilots, represented by the Air Line Pilots ...

How much do Delta Air Lines Pilots make? Interview Info Study Guide Sim / Scenario Pilot Pay All Companies Pilot pay at Delta Air Lines ranges from $66,853.80 per year for a new first officer up to $257,657.40 per year for a senior captain.

A provisional contract seen by Reuters reveals that Delta Air Lines pilots have been offered a pay increase of at least 18% on the date the contract is signed, followed by an additional 5% after one year, 4% after two years and 4% after three years. On top of this, pilots will be given a one-time payment amounting to 22% of their earnings ...
